Support your pet’s natural chewing behavior with this Natural Woven Carrot Chew Toy, designed specifically for all types of rodents. Sold as a 2-piece set, these chew toys are crafted from natural woven plant fibers, ensuring they are safe, non-toxic, and suitable for daily gnawing. 📏 Product Dimensions: • Length: 10 cm (3.8 inches) • Shape: Carrot • Pack Size: 2 pieces The textured braided design helps wear down continuously growing teeth, which is essential for maintaining proper dental health in rodents. ✅ Suitable for ALL Rodents: • Hamsters (Syrian, Dwarf, Roborovski) • Guinea pigs • Rabbits • Rats & mice • Gerbils • Degus • Chinchillas • Chipmunks • Other small rodents 🌿 Key Benefits: • Promotes healthy teeth and gums • Encourages natural chewing and gnawing instincts • Helps reduce boredom, stress, and cage chewing • Made from natural, pet-safe fibers • Lightweight and easy to place in cages, tanks, or play areas The 10 cm (3.8 in) size makes these carrot chew toys ideal for both small and medium-sized rodents, providing long-lasting enrichment without being too large or heavy. 🐾 Ideal For: • Daily chewing activity • Cage enrichment and toy rotation • Active and curious rodents • Preventing destructive behavior This 2-pack natural carrot chew toy for rodents is an essential enrichment accessory for hamster cages, rabbit enclosures, guinea pig habitats, and all small animal homes.
